Understanding Solar Inverters
Solar panels capture sunlight, but your home runs on AC electricity. That’s where the inverter steps in! Think of it as a translator, converting the DC power from your panels into usable AC power for your appliances. Inverters also control the flow and maximize the power you generate from the sun.

Off Grid Inverter
Off-grid inverters do not synchronize with the grid and works alone; meaning that this inverter is used when there is no grid power available and it supplies DC to AC instantly to power up appliances.

Grid Tied Inverter
Grid tied inverters connect our homes and can supplement all our surplus power back to the grid. This type of inverter delivers power to your appliances directly from your PV array when solar power is available and switches back to the grid when not calculating usage for the average home.

Hybrid Inverter
Hybrid inverters are a combination between solar and battery inverters, intelligently managing power from PV panels, batteries and grid at the same time.
A hybrid solar inverter is the combination of a solar inverter and a battery inverter into a single piece of equipment that can intelligently manage power from your solar panels, solar batteries and the utility grid at the same time.

How long do solar panels and batteries last?
Solar panels typically last 20–25 years, while lithium batteries last 8–12 years with proper care.
